1865
Mr James Cameron Island Feb 5th 1865
John Angus James Hugh went off I went as far as Peters B stormy some
6th Grinding axes cut down the Hicory at the Lower Point
7th Drawing wood
8th Gordons Birth Day Breaking Roads
9th Drawing Wood stormy weather these Days
10 cutting stove Wood
11th Went to Williamstown a Treat Harpers -/7 1/2 a Treat at Davids Bad Roads on the ice Old Pge died
12th Went to see Ellen
13th came Home a Very Frosty night Last night the coldest I felt this Winter Bought of Mr Harper 1 squaw Broom -/7 1/2 1 yd of Tobacco -/7 1/2 stopt at Archy Campbells
14th St Valentines Day a Ball at D Summers to night
15th Drawing Wood Kenneth MDonnell Drawing his Marsh hay home Clows taking over oats
16th Went to Mr Harpers 67 lb of Oats 1/2 lb Tea 1/10/1/2 1/2 Gal syrup 1/10 1/2 2 lb of Butter -2/- 10 bl Beef 3/6 Treat Matches -/10 Jim Hopkins wife at Hamiltons
17th Drawing Wood
18th stormy James Hughs Birth Day
19th Sunday
20th Drawing Wood
21st Went to Salmon River Bought of GA Streeter 1 pair of Boots 2 1/2 Our money Left my old Boots to be mended Bought of Rob Baker 1 Tumbler -/6 paid Congdon 5 cents Bought 2 Siscos 3 cents 2 cents for candy got a Ride from Comrie acrofs stopt at Angus Camerons all night Bought Mr Harper 1 Bottle Whiskey -/7 1/2 seen Lauries Boy
22 came home Mrs Christee here with 2 pictures for Potatoes
23 Went to Mr Harpers 109 lbs Peas 1 Gal syrup 3/9 1/2 lb Tea 1/10 1/2 Treat -/7 1/2 went up with Thomas Munroe & Bill McLeod
{second page}
Mr James Cameron Island 24th Feby 1865
Mending Harnefs a Rout at Christees about stolen clothes
25th Writing a Letter for Christees about the ill usage they got yesterday Brought me a Letter Back from Norman concerning the stealing of D McRae clothes splitt 2 sticks for Rails crust not good
26th Raining some
27th chopping stove Wood
28th Last Day of the Month stormy snowing fixing straw in the Barn on 1 side
1st of March Ash Wednesday snowing some Fine Day took home 2 Loads of Wood not very well
2nd Went to Summers sold the timber to A Summers for L5..0..0.. 1 lb of tea on the Bargain Endorsed it on my Note took Dinner with Him Bought of Mrs Harper 1/2 lb saleratus -/4 1/2 lb Candles -/5 1 plug Tobacco /2 pipe 1/12 Treat -/4 Fixing the Ashes in the Bags 3 Bags of Ashes Mr Harper to Montreal Mrs Christee here Gave her some Pease
3rd snowing Raining went to A Summer with the Ashes 4 Bushes 2/6 Brought a Bag of Oats Bought of Mr Harper 1/2 Gal syrup 1/10 1/2 10 lb Beef 1 Doz Herrings 2 1/2 cents coming to Me Got some yeast from Lydia Ann
4th stormy day Christees here for Potatoes Brought a small smootheron to sell
5th Went to Christees
6th Went to Mr Harpers 1 lb sugar -/ 7 1/2 1/2 Gal oil 1/8 Treat -/7 1/2 Angus on the Front Renting the House to Carey a Treat at Davids 2/- My Mare Run away twice at Renshaws Island Lashey caught the Mare
7th Went to Dundee Got the Pots from the Old Lady Christees took their Pot here a Treat about Wade selling Men Emmanuel Poorly First crows I seen
